• 古往今来,读圣贤书,所学何事?无疑明是非,分黑白,而如今,为中华崛起而读书

x86汇编语言:编写64位多处理器多线程操作系统

学习教育 22小时前 已收录 0个评论 扫描二维码
文章目录[隐藏]

x86汇编语言:编写64位多处理器多线程操作系统

书名:x86汇编语言:编写64位多处理器多线程操作系统

作者:李忠 等

格式:MOBI/AZW3/EPUB

标签:学习 计算机

日期:2024-12-31

 

内容简介

编写一个简单的、简易的操作系统雏形,用来演示64位环境下的多处理器管理、动态内存分配、多处理器多任务的调度和切换、多处理器多线程的调度和切换、数据竞争和锁,但它不包括文件管理、设备管理等内容。

本书主要聚焦以下问题:

1,与IA-32架构进行对比,介绍64位处理器的基本架构,包括寄存器的变化、指令集和工作模式的变化、系统表的变化、内存组织和内存访问模式的变化;

2,IA-32e模式的特点及如何进入IA-32e模式,重点介绍其64位子模式;

3,IA-32e模式的4级和5级分页;

4,IA-32e模式下的中断和异常处理;

5,64位模式下的单处理器多任务和任务切换;

6,64位模式下的多处理器管理和初始化,包括高级可编程中断控制器APIC;

7,64位模式下的多处理器多任务和任务切换;

8,64位模式下的多处理器多线程和线程切换;

9,高速缓存及与多线程有关的原子操作、锁、线程同步,等等。

x86汇编语言:编写64位多处理器多线程操作系统下载地址已隐藏,输入验证码即可查看!(建议使用Chrome内核的浏览器)
请关注本站微信公众号,回复“验证码”,获取验证码。在微信里搜索“李畅随笔”或者“lichangsuibi”或者微信扫描右侧二维码都可以关注本站微信公众号。【验证码不定期更换】

微信打赏
喜欢 (0)
[微信扫码打赏]
分享 (0)
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址